Literature summary for 5.3.3.1 extracted from

  • Kim, S.W.; Choi, K.Y.
    Identification of active site residues by site-directed mutagenesis of DELTA5-3-ketosteroid isomerase from Pseudomonas putida biotype B (1995), J. Bacteriol., 177, 2602-2605.

Protein Variants

Protein Variants Comment Organism
D40N 1484555fold decrease in turnover number, 4.46fold decrease in KM-value as compared to wild-type enzyme Pseudomonas putida
Y16F 2009fold decrease in turnover number, 3.5fold decrease in KM-value as compared to wild-type enzyme Pseudomonas putida
